The value of a 1971 2 pence coin can vary depending on its condition and whether it’s a regular strike, a proof issue, or a rare error coin.

  • Condition: A coin in excellent condition with minimal wear will be more valuable than a heavily circulated one.
  • Errors: Coins with minting errors, such as double strikes, die skews, or those struck on the wrong blank, can be significantly more valuable.
  • Proof Issues: These are coins specially minted for collectors with a higher quality finish. A 1971 proof 2 pence coin in perfect condition can fetch a higher price.
  • Rarity: While 1971 2 pence coins are relatively common, certain rare varieties, like those with specific errors or limited proof issues, can be highly sought after.
  • Regular circulated coins: These are generally worth between $1 and $10.
  • Rare or uncirculated coins: You might find these listed on platforms like [Etsy for around $109.70] or [eBay for upwards of $2,120].
  • Error coins or rare proofs: These can command much higher prices, potentially reaching hundreds or even thousands of dollars. One such listing on [eBay, for instance, prices an error 1971 2p at $1,000] . Another listing for a rare, uncirculated 1971 2p on [Etsy is listed at $500].

Note: It’s important to be cautious of scams and verify the authenticity and true value of coins before purchasing, especially those listed at exceptionally high prices. Checking the sold items filter on eBay or consulting reputable auction sites and coin grading services like PCGS or NGC can provide a more accurate assessment of a coin’s market value.

      Great question! All 2p coins struck between 1971 and 1981 included the words ‘NEW PENCE’ as part of their reverse. In 1982 and in subsequent years the words ‘NEW PENCE’ were replaced with the word ‘TWO PENCE’. However, in 1983 a small number of 2p coins were mistakenly struck with the wording ‘NEW PENCE’ on the reverse.
